/* Contenu original de job-overview.css */
/*
Theme Name: Cariera Child
Theme URI: https://jobiizy.com/
Author: Gilles
Author URI: https://jobiizy.com/
Version: 1.0.1
Text Domain: cariera-child
*/

.jobiizy-overview {
  background: #fff;
  border-radius: 8px;
  box-shadow: 0 2px 20px rgba(0,0,0,0.1);
  padding: 1.5rem;
  max-width: 350px;
}
.jobiizy-overview .tw-tag-grey-s {
  background: #f5f5f5;
  border-radius: 4px;
  padding: 4px 10px;
  font-size: 0.85rem;
  display: inline-block;
  margin-right: 6px;
}
.jobiizy-overview .tw-btn-primary-candidacy-l {
  background-color: #5b3efc;
  color: #fff;
  border-radius: 24px;
  padding: 12px 20px;
  font-weight: 600;
  text-align: center;
  display: block;
  margin-top: 20px;
  transition: background 0.3s ease;
}
.jobiizy-overview .tw-btn-primary-candidacy-l:hover {
  background-color: #432bd8;
}


/* --- Harmonisation visuelle popup Cariera avec style Jobiizy --- */
#login-register-popup.small-dialog {
  border-radius: 16px;
  overflow: hidden;
  box-shadow: 0 20px 60px rgba(0, 0, 0, 0.4);
}

#login-register-popup h3.title {
  font-family: "Inter", sans-serif;
  font-weight: 700;
  color: #1a1a1a;
}

#login-register-popup input.form-control {
  border-radius: 8px;
  border: 1px solid #ddd;
  padding: 10px 14px;
}

#login-register-popup .btn.btn-main {
  border-radius: 10px;
  background: linear-gradient(135deg, #040a8e 0%, #0612b8 100%);
  color: #fff;
  font-weight: 600;
}

#login-register-popup .btn.btn-main:hover {
  background: linear-gradient(135deg, #0612b8 0%, #040a8e 100%);
}